The Sr. Manager of Systems Engineering at Global Security Design & Engineering (GSDE) is a senior technical leader responsible for defining and governing the architecture of core security technology platforms such as access control, video management, and records management systems. This role involves developing long-term platform strategies, ensuring interoperability across regions, and partnering with Enterprise Technology to align system designs with enterprise standards. The Sr. Manager will establish governance frameworks, optimize system performance, and serve as a liaison between Global Security, GSDE, and business unit stakeholders, translating business requirements into scalable technical solutions. Ideal candidates have over 10 years of experience in security systems architecture, expertise in physical security platforms, and the ability to manage complex multi-platform systems across multiple geographies. Preferred qualifications include familiarity with enterprise IT systems, cloud environments, and system lifecycle management strategies.
